Jointly with NOAA/SEC researchers, we issue Space Weather Forecasts (description) of the arrival of interplanetary shocks, based upon event reports from solar observatories and space weather forecast centers. Please note: this is NOT an official SEC product.
We used the Hakamada-Akasofu-Fry (HAF) solar wind model to simulate the ecliptic-plane interplanetary magnetic field (IMF) and dynamic pressure during the period July 10-18, 2000. Check out our archives of model runs.
